Transaction 19fc82325b383fa4b53169730bfc8f00faa1c88a4e84a6fcf20a71eed29d1329
1 Input
1 Output
-
19fc82325b383fa4b53169730bfc8f00faa1c88a4e84a6fcf20a71eed29d1329:0
- value
- 378245623
- script pubkey
- OP_0 OP_PUSHBYTES_20 1895fa11ce2a66fe2b8cbf954af1aeb55632df41
- address
- bc1qrz2l5yww9fn0u2uvh7254udwk4tr9h6pljvzgv